How soon after a water leak does mold become a major concern?

The microbial amplification window is 48-72 hours in typical Michigan conditions. By 2026, insurance carriers and courts view any mitigation delay beyond this window as a failure of the Standard of Care, shifting liability for resultant mold growth to the property owner. Immediate, documented intervention is required to preserve your claim and prevent a Category 1 (clean water) loss from escalating to a Category 3 (black water) remediation.

Why does my floor feel dry but still need professional drying in North Branch Township?

A surface feeling 'dry to the touch' is a psychrometric illusion. The S500 standard of care requires drying to a specific equilibrium moisture content, which for North Branch Township is approximately 40 Grains Per Pound (GPP) at 70°F. Residual vapor pressure within materials like subflooring will drive moisture to the surface, causing secondary damage. We use thermo-hygrometers and deep-probe meters to measure GPP, not touch.

Does North Branch Township's 'Zone X' flood rating mean my basement is safe from water damage?

No. Zone X (Minimal Flood Hazard) from FEMA relates to riverine flooding risk, not plumbing failures or groundwater intrusion. The 2026 FEMA Risk MAP updates emphasize that all basements and crawlspaces are inherently damp environments. A water intrusion event, even in Zone X, requires the same rigorous structural drying protocols—including vapor barrier deployment and negative air pressure—to prevent mold and material degradation.

What is the first thing I should do when I discover a major water leak?

Immediately locate and operate the main water shut-off valve. This is the single most critical step in 'loss of use' mitigation, stopping the flow and limiting damage. What's the difference between 'Grey Water' and 'Black Water' in an insurance claim?

Category 2 'Grey Water' contains significant contamination (e.g., dishwasher overflow, washing machine discharge) and requires antimicrobial treatment. Category 3 'Black Water' is grossly contaminated (e.g., sewage, floodwater). Proper categorization dictates the remediation protocol and impacts coverage.
